import 'dart:async';
import 'dart:io';
import 'package:clide/clide.dart' show FileEntry;
import 'package:clide/kernel/kernel.dart';
import 'package:clide/widgets/widgets.dart';
import 'package:flutter/widgets.dart';
import 'file_tree_controller.dart';
/// Sidebar panel rendering the workspace file tree.
///
/// Lazy-expands directories via `files.ls`, subscribes to
/// `files.changed` events from the daemon, and refreshes the affected
/// subtrees on change. Click-to-open is plumbed through `kernel.commands`
/// — today the command doesn't exist yet (lands with Tier 2's editor);
/// the view degrades gracefully to a no-op when the command isn't
/// registered.
class FileTreeView extends StatefulWidget {
const FileTreeView({super.key});
@override
State<FileTreeView> createState() => _FileTreeViewState();
}
class _FileTreeViewState extends State<FileTreeView> {
FileTreeController? _controller;
String _filter = '';
final ScrollController _scroll = ScrollController();
/// Key on the currently-selected row, so a keyboard move can scroll it into
/// view (T-406).
final GlobalKey _selectedKey = GlobalKey();
/// Half-page step for ctrl+d / ctrl+u over the flattened tree.
static const int _pageStep = 10;
@override
void didChangeDependencies() {
super.didChangeDependencies();
if (_controller != null) return;
final kernel = ClideKernel.of(context);
_controller = FileTreeController(ipc: kernel.ipc, events: kernel.events);
unawaited(_controller!.load());
}
@override
void dispose() {
_controller?.dispose();
_scroll.dispose();
super.dispose();
}
void _onNav(NavIntent intent, int count, FileTreeController c) {
switch (intent) {
case NavDownIntent():
c.moveSelection(count);
case NavUpIntent():
c.moveSelection(-count);
case NavPageDownIntent():
c.moveSelection(_pageStep);
case NavPageUpIntent():
c.moveSelection(-_pageStep);
case NavTopIntent():
c.selectEdge(top: true);
case NavBottomIntent():
c.selectEdge(top: false);
case NavExpandOrRightIntent():
unawaited(c.expandOrInto());
case NavCollapseOrLeftIntent():
unawaited(c.collapseOrOut());
case NavActivateIntent():
_activateSelected(c);
}
}
void _activateSelected(FileTreeController c) {
final t = c.activateTarget();
if (t == null) return;
if (t.isDirectory) {
unawaited(c.toggle(t.path));
} else {
openWorkspaceFile(ClideKernel.of(context), t.path);
}
}
/// Scroll the selected row into view after the frame it's laid out in.
void _ensureSelectedVisible() {
WidgetsBinding.instance.addPostFrameCallback((_) {
final ctx = _selectedKey.currentContext;
if (ctx == null) return;
Scrollable.ensureVisible(ctx, alignmentPolicy: ScrollPositionAlignmentPolicy.keepVisibleAtEnd, duration: const Duration(milliseconds: 80));
});
}
@override
Widget build(BuildContext context) {
final c = _controller;
if (c == null) return const SizedBox.shrink();
return ListenableBuilder(
listenable: c,
builder: (context, _) {
if (c.error != null && c.rootPath == null) {
return Padding(padding: const EdgeInsets.all(12), child: ClideText(c.error!, muted: true));
}
final root = c.rootPath;
if (root == null) {
return Padding(
padding: const EdgeInsets.all(12),
child: ClideText(ClideSettings.i18n.string(context, 'loading', namespace: 'builtin.files', placeholder: 'Loading…'), muted: true),
);
}
final rootName = root.split(Platform.pathSeparator).last;
final selected = c.selectedPath;
if (_filter.isEmpty && selected != null) _ensureSelectedVisible();
final scroller = SingleChildScrollView(
controller: _scroll,
padding: const EdgeInsets.symmetric(vertical: 4),
child: Column(
crossAxisAlignment: CrossAxisAlignment.stretch,
mainAxisSize: MainAxisSize.min,
children: [
if (_filter.isEmpty) ...[
_DirRow(name: rootName, path: '', controller: c, depth: 0, selectedPath: selected, selectedKey: _selectedKey),
if (c.isExpanded('')) _Children(path: '', controller: c, depth: 1, selectedPath: selected, selectedKey: _selectedKey),
] else
..._filteredEntries(c),
],
),
);
return Column(
children: [
ClideFilterBox(
address: 'files.tree',
hint: ClideSettings.i18n.string(context, 'filter.hint', namespace: 'builtin.files', placeholder: 'Filter files…'),
onChanged: (v) => setState(() => _filter = v),
),
Expanded(
child: Semantics(
label: ClideSettings.i18n.interpolated(
context,
'a11y.tree',
namespace: 'builtin.files',
placeholder: 'file tree — {name}',
replacers: [I18nReplacer(from: '{name}', replace: rootName)],
),
container: true,
explicitChildNodes: true,
// Vim nav (j/k/h/l/gg/G/o) drives a selection cursor while this
// region holds focus under the vim preset (T-406). The filter
// box sits outside it, so typing a filter is never intercepted.
child: _filter.isEmpty ? PaneKeyNav(onNav: (intent, count) => _onNav(intent, count, c), child: scroller) : scroller,
),
),
],
);
},
);
}
List<Widget> _filteredEntries(FileTreeController c) {
final lowerFilter = _filter.toLowerCase();
final matches = c.allLoadedEntries().where((e) {
return e.path.toLowerCase().contains(lowerFilter) || e.name.toLowerCase().contains(lowerFilter);
}).toList();
return [for (final e in matches) _FilteredFileRow(entry: e)];
}
}
